Job summary

DaVita is seeking a Patient Care Technician (PCT) to support patients with end-stage renal disease in an outpatient dialysis clinic in Wisconsin Dells. You will provide direct, hands-on care under RN supervision during dialysis treatment.

The role involves monitoring patients before, during, and after treatment; setting up and maintaining dialysis equipment; recording vital signs; and educating patients on kidney health.

Qualifications

  • Accredited high school diploma or GED or equivalent.
  • Comfortable around blood, needles, and medical equipment.
  • Physically able to stand for long shifts.
  • Willing to float between local clinics if needed.
  • Flexible schedule including mornings, evenings, weekends and holidays.
  • Preferred: CNA, MA, CHT, phlebotomy or healthcare experience.

Responsibilities

  • Deliver safe, hygienic dialysis care under RN supervision.
  • Monitor patients before, during, and after treatment.
  • Set up and maintain dialysis equipment.
  • Record vital signs and patient data.
  • Educate patients on treatment and kidney health.
  • Collaborate with nurses, dietitians, social workers, and care team.
